While the design is certainly unique, if you're after a pack that can be stripped down for day hikes, cycling trips or just ultralight trips while still having the ability to clip on an extra 15L at a moments notice, the PK50 may just be perfect. The website doesnt mention that the aluminium frame is removable (so is the plastic reinforcement) so if you're looking to shed a little more weight its easily done. No complaints so far, great pack.
